Indices

If Index marking is selected as the
“press” option for Custom Setting g1
(Assign Fn button; 0 361), g2 (Assign

preview button; 0 362), or g3 (Assign

AE-L/AF-L button; 0 363), you can
press the selected button during
recording to add indices that can be
used to locate frames during editing and
playback (0 66). Up to 20 indices can be
added to each movie.

See Also

Frame size, frame rate, microphone sensitivity, card slot, and ISO
sensitivity options are available in the Movie settings menu (0 62).
Focus can be adjusted manually as described on page 41. The roles
played by the center of the multi selector, the Fn, Pv, and A AE-L/AF-L
buttons can be chosen using Custom Settings f2 (Multi selector

center button; 0 341), g1 (Assign Fn button; 0 361), g2 (Assign

preview button; 0 362), and g3 (Assign AE-L/AF-L button, 0 363;
this option also allows exposure to be locked without keeping the
A AE-L/AF-L button pressed), respectively. Custom Setting g4 (Assign

shutter button; 0 364) controls whether the shutter-release button
can be used to start movie live view or to start and end movie
recording. For information on preventing unintended operation of the
a button, see Custom Setting f14 (Live view button options; 0 356).
